Output f74d23433361fd3ce2c766abebd1138e24aeb8f87cc64d5fcd2797ac245dbe23:132

value
152733
script pubkey
OP_0 OP_PUSHBYTES_20 ea66da8e7bed572e180e498a9479f128cb47416f
address
bc1qafnd4rnma4tjuxqwfx9fg7039r95wst05p4zrz
transaction
f74d23433361fd3ce2c766abebd1138e24aeb8f87cc64d5fcd2797ac245dbe23